'Opaeka'a Falls in Wailua Homesteads, Hawaii, offers a scenic view that can be appreciated from a distance, primarily from the parking lot. While the waterfall itself is pretty, visitors might find it less impressive compared to other nearby attractions, such as Wailua Falls. The accessibility is easy, with amenities like restrooms available, but ongoing construction limits closer access to the falls. Although the drive and views can be enjoyable, some might consider skipping it if it's their first visit to the area due to its limited appeal.
